From a press release: While the coronavirus pandemic continues to prevent new shows from being staged across the area this year, the Northeastern Pennsylvania Theatrical Alliance was still able to host its 23rd annual NEPTA Awards for 2019 productions online on Sunday, June 7. From a press release: The Pocono Mountains Theater Company will return to the Poconos with a production of “A Number,” a play addressing the subjects of human cloning and identity by award-winning British playwright Caryl Churchill.
